The Evolution of Electronic Device History Registration in Health Information Systems

Introduction: In today's digital era, electronic devices play a pivotal role in our daily lives. From smartphones to wearable devices, these gadgets have become essential tools that empower us with information and connectivity. However, their impact extends beyond personal use, particularly in the healthcare sector. Electronic Device History Registration, or EDHR, within health information systems has revolutionized the way medical professionals and patients access and manage health information. In this blog post, we will explore the evolution of EDHR and its significance in modern healthcare. 1. The Emergence of Electronic Health Records (EHRs): The transition from paper-based medical records to electronic health records marked a significant milestone in healthcare digitization. EHRs brought efficiency and accuracy to the management of patient data, enabling healthcare providers to access comprehensive medical histories with just a few clicks. These systems paved the way for the integration of electronic device histories, allowing for a holistic understanding of an individual's health. 2. Integration of Wearable Devices: With the rise of wearable devices, such as fitness trackers, smartwatches, and even implantable medical devices, the possibilities for collecting health-related data expanded exponentially. These devices started to gather vital signs, activity levels, sleep patterns, and more. By linking these devices to health information systems, healthcare providers gained access to valuable real-time data, allowing for better monitoring and analysis. 3. Enhanced Patient Engagement and Self-Care: Electronic device history registration has empowered patients to actively participate in their healthcare journeys. Through mobile applications and patient portals, individuals can sync their wearable devices and other health monitoring tools with their electronic health records. This integration encourages patients to take charge of their health, monitor their progress, and share valuable insights with their healthcare providers remotely. 4. Improved Disease Management and Research: By seamlessly integrating electronic devices into health information systems, researchers and healthcare professionals can access tremendous amounts of data for disease management and research purposes. The aggregated data captured through electronic device history registration enables the analysis of population-level health trends, leading to valuable insights for public health initiatives and personalized medicine. 5. Privacy and Security Challenges: As healthcare systems increasingly rely on electronic device history registration, the importance of data privacy and security cannot be overstated. Protecting sensitive health information from unauthorized access or breaches is of utmost importance. Health organizations and technology providers must implement robust security measures and adhere to strict privacy regulations to maintain patient trust and data integrity. Conclusion: The integration of electronic device history registration in health information systems has transformed the healthcare landscape. From electronic health records to wearable devices, this technology evolution has empowered patients, improved disease management, and elevated the quality of healthcare services. As we move forward, it is crucial to prioritize data privacy and security to ensure the continued success and sustainable adoption of electronic device history registration in healthcare.
